Finally, the creeks have had a chance to drop and clear. Expect clear to slightly stained water area wide today
Things are going well with a large variety of bugs hatching and fish feeding on the surface in the later afternoon and evening on sulphurs, caddis, and craneflies. During the day, we are fishing dry dropper with a hippie stomper or training wheel up top and a scud or pink belly PT below.
Leeches are still great on the stained water, and on the clear water we are getting fish to eat on scuds, heavy pheasant tails, ice cream cones, and brush hogs.
